Plant Bio
Tulipa dobarica is a species tulip native to the Balkans, known for its bright yellow flowers and early spring bloom time.
Unlike many other tulip species, Tulipa dobarica has a more drought-tolerant nature and specific adaptability to different soil types.

Planting
How to Grow
- Choose well-drained soil with a neutral to slightly acidic pH.
- Plant bulbs 4-6 inches deep in the fall, pointed end up.
- Water thoroughly after planting to settle soil around bulbs.
- Apply a layer of mulch to protect from extreme cold and retain moisture.
- Allow bulbs to grow and bloom in early spring, providing periodic watering.
- Lift and store bulbs in dry, cool conditions after foliage dies back.
Pro Tip
Plant bulbs in clusters for a more natural and dramatic display.
Keep It Thriving
Care Guide
Do
- Tuck bulbs into well-draining soil before winter 🌱
- Water sparingly during dormancy
- Fertilize with a balanced bulb fertilizer in early spring
Don't
- Don't overwater to prevent bulb rot ❌
- Avoid planting in heavy, clay soils without amendment
- Don't cut back foliage until it yellows naturally

Common Questions
Dobrica Tulip questions
What zones can Dobrica Tulip grow in?
Dobrica Tulip is hardy in USDA Zones 4–8. Inside that range it survives winter in the ground; outside it, grow it as an annual or a container plant you protect.
Is Dobrica Tulip deer resistant?
Yes — Dobrica Tulip is rated deer-resistant. Deer typically pass it over, though extreme hunger can override any plant's defenses.
When does Dobrica Tulip bloom?
Dobrica Tulip typically blooms in early spring through late spring. Exact timing shifts a week or two with your zone — Sow's bloom calendar maps it to your garden.
Does Dobrica Tulip need full sun?
Dobrica Tulip does best in full sun to part shade. In hot climates, afternoon shade keeps blooms fresher longer.
